The University of South Carolina Upstate’s George Dean Johnson, Jr. College of Business and Economics announces that Dr. Daniel Dresibach, a Rhodes scholar and professor at American University’s School of Public Affairs, will be the guest speaker at the Wells Fargo Speaker Series event at 8:30 a.m. Thursday, Feb. 20 at the Chapman Cultural Center.

Dreisbach, who received his bachelor’s degree in 1981 from the University of South Carolina Upstate, will speak on “Visualizing Liberty in the New Nation.” His presentation will examine the images and symbols of liberty in late-18th-century political, religious, and popular culture, many of which remain familiar features of 21stYeah-century discussions of freedom and liberty.
